FRIDAY, DEC. 19
No. 9 Alabama @ No. 8 Oklahoma (8 p.m. ET, ABC)
Spread: Alabama -1.5
Moneyline: Alabama -112, Oklahoma -108
O/U: 40.5
What to know: These two teams faced off during the regular season, back on Nov. 15. In that game, the Sooners traveled to Alabama and beat the Tide, 23-21. Most notably, OU quarterback John Mateer had arguably his most ho-hum game of the season, completing 15 of 23 passes for 138 yards and no passing TDs, although he did rush one in. In addition, Alabama led 10-0 in the first quarter and 17-7 in the second. However, a fumble by Bama QB Ty Simpson late in the third quarter — in Alabama territory — led to an OU field goal to take a 23-21 lead at 13:41 of the fourth quarter, and neither team scored again. Yep, one turnover essentially decided that contest. Oklahoma would go on to close its regular season with wins over Missouri and LSU, while the Tide would beat Eastern Illinois and Auburn in the final two weeks, before falling to Georgia in the SEC title game.
